When designing a plan for pain management for a postoperative patient, the nurse assess that the patients priority is to be as free of pain as possible. The nurse and patient work together to identify a plan to manage the pain. The nurse continually reviews the plan with the patient to ensure that the patient's priority is met. Which principle is used to encourage the nurse to monitor the patient's response to the pain?

1 Fidelity
2 Beneficence
3 Nonmaleficence
4 Respect for autonomy

The principle used to encourage the nurse to monitor the patient's response to pain in the given scenario is Respect for autonomy. Respect for autonomy is the principle that states that patients have the right to make decisions about their own health care. By continually reviewing the pain management plan with the patient, the nurse ensures that the patient's priority of being as free of pain as possible is being met, and respects the patient's autonomy in managing their pain.
